方正科技EAI-解決方案_第1頁
方正科技EAI-解決方案_第2頁
方正科技EAI-解決方案_第3頁
方正科技EAI-解決方案_第4頁
全文預覽已結束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、eai實戰一一方正科技的eai實踐1背景方正科技一直堅持以自主建造為主的信息化建設道路,經過7年多努力,借 鑒國內外先進的it思想和技術,建成適合公司實際需要的、比較完善的信息系 統。隨著信息化程度的不斷提高,公司提出了更高的要求,于是采用分塊建造的 it建設模式的局限性就顯現出來了。為此,在2001年中,公司和微軟中國顧問咨詢部合作,開始進行了整個公司信 息系統的整合。整個過程包括了很多內容,現在就eai部分的實踐和經驗與大家 分享。2實施eai前的系統狀況由于對于it系統業內還沒有真正公認的分類標準,每個公司為便于管理,又有 不同的分類方法。為便于理解,這里參照業內的比較通用的分類方法,主

2、耍有以 下部分:供應鏈與生產:功能與業內常見的mrptt和供應鏈管理基本相同,包括銷售計劃、 生產計劃、物料運算、生產管理、材料庫管理、采購管理等。商務與物流:包括b2b、b2c電子商務、訂單管理、信用、分銷商管理、物流、 倉儲以及條碼管理等。服務:包括ceill center.服務管理、備件管理等。其它部分:以notes為基礎的oa系統;crm的部分功能;成本財務核算系統; 還包括外購的人事、財務、信用、立體倉庫等諸多系統。以前這些系統以幾個主題為屮心,相對比較獨立。但是隨著業務的發展,整合這 些系統成為當務之急。所以到2001年中,ea1項目便成為當務之急。3方案選擇及考慮方案1:購買整套

3、的erp和crm系統,替換原先的系統。考慮到原有系統很適合 公司實際應用,公司多數用戶不贊成更換;另外,erp和crm系統昂貴的價格、 巨大的實施風險、有爭議的效果,這些也是我們不選擇這個方案的原因。方案2:進行企業應用系統整合(eat),通過進行eai,實現靈活、開放的企業 應用系統架構,保護了先期it投資,又能保證以后的系統擴展,同時保證整個 1t建設保持最佳價格性能比。根據以上分析,我們選擇了使用ea1的方式。在技術方案上,由于方正的it架構一直是基于微軟解決方案的,加上微軟與方 正是戰略合作伙伴,微軟解決方案的成木也比較低,所以最后選擇了 biztalk 作為主要平臺,結合xml技術和

4、rosettanet標準,實施企業應用系統集成。作為信息化比較早的企業,方正一直堅持根據自己的實際情況,結合使用國內最 先進的技術來實現自己的1t建設,不盲目跟風,不盲從最貴的最大的系統,這 也是本次eai方案的主要依據。4 eai過程介紹(1)ea1的基礎,數據級的集成考慮到系統的現實情況,首先實現數據級的集成,通過為每個系統建立adapter, 將需要集成的數據放入企業數據總線(bi/talk)中,從而實現各個系統的應用 集成。所有的數據交換采用xml標準。在這個層面上解決了數據庫間的數據移動 問題,實現起來也比較簡單,程序的修改并不多??傮w結構示意如下:廣金篠財務系綻r廠該翔條索統r嚴國

5、綾c敘一廠酩菱企ii嗷抵總線-biztalk(2)消息級集成一一使用消息機制但是數據集成多是傳統的database to database方式的集成,要真正實現比較 開放和靈活的系統,需要實現application to application模式的集成,這樣 就需要進行消息級的集成;因為系統主要使用c0m+技術,某些系統又使用了不 同的技術,為了實現一個開放式的應用系統,同時采用了同步和異步的消息機制, 微軟的msmq提供了方便的開發接口,所以在eai屮廣泛使用了 msmq技術。下面就是一個使用msmq消息機制來實現集成的設計案例:(3) eai高級應用和擴展一一業務級的集成和企業間系統接合

6、隨著內部eai項目的成功實施,公司乂提出了更高的要求,緊接著就開始進行業 務級集成。一個比較典型的案例就是founder和intel之間的rosettanet項目 的實施,使得公司信息系統的透明化、與合作伙伴間的系統連接又人人前進了一 步。下面是rosettanet方案的示意圖:biztalk 實現 rosettan etf oim de f與intel系統連通1. buyer create order3. forward to inteltebco6.3a4 message4. create or de to erpfoiin<erp2. send create orderintel

7、erpbiztajk server5 一些經驗重視業務流程重組:因為eai涉及到多系統的整合,特別是進行到業務級的 整合時,經常會發生業務流程的重組,這時高層領導的支持和介入就很重要。使用xml:無論哪個級別的eai,不同系統間的信息交換都是最基本的問題,使 用統一的xml標準不但使用方便,而且大大減少了傳換的工作量。使用消息機制:事務一直是分布式系統的一個難題,無論是c0m+還是ejb,分布 式事務的實現都是一個難點,使用消息機制不但可以使整個企業系統高度模塊 化,還能一定程度的解決異步和長事務問題。獲得合適的adapter: adapter是eai實現中的難點,尤其是存在跨平臺、多系 統的環境中尤其重要,比如環境中如果同時存在sap、oracle和其他系統,集成 這些系統,合適的a

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論